(Determine adjustment shim for input shaft)
Special tools, testers and auxiliary items required
• Dial gauge holder (VW 387)
• Magnetic plate 50MM dia. (VW 385/17)
• Thrust pad (VW 510)
• Thrust pad (VW 447 i)
• Punch (VW 407)
• Torque wrench 5 to 50 Nm (V.A.G 1331)
• Transmission support (VW 353)
• Dial gauge
It is only necessary to readjust input shaft if following components are replaced:
• Transmission housing
• Clutch housing
• Input shaft
• Drive gear for 4th gear
or
• Tapered roller bearing
Adjustment overview => [ Adjustment Overview ] Adjustment Overview.
Requirement
• Sealing surfaces of clutch and transmission housings must be cleaned of sealant.
- Press tapered roller bearing outer race without adjustment shim into clutch housing until stop.
- Install input shaft in clutch housing and install transmission housing. Tighten hex bolts to 25 Nm + an additional 90°.
- Install measuring device and dial gauge into clutch housing (large tapered roller bearing in transmission housing).
- Rotate input shaft before measuring procedure so that tapered roller bearing settles.
- Set dial gauge to "0" with 1 mm preload.
• This procedure must be repeated for each subsequent measurement, otherwise the dial gauge will not return to the initial position.
- Push input shaft in direction of dial gauge in direction of - arrow -.
- Read play on dial indicator and note (example 1.21).
• Dial gauge does not return to initial position.
- Determine thickness of adjustment shim from table => [ Adjustment Shim Table ] , (example 1.175).
- Remove input shaft and press tapered roller bearing outer race out of transmission housing using thrust pad (VW 447 i).
- Press tapered roller bearing outer race together with 1.175 adjustment shim into transmission housing using thrust pad (VW 510 ).
- Install transmission housing and tighten hex bolt to 25 Nm + an additional 90°.

Performing Measurement Check
- Install measuring device and dial gauge.
- Rotate input shaft so that tapered roller bearings settle.
- Press input shaft in direction of - arrow -.
- Bearing play should be min. 0.01 to max. 0.09 mm.
• If the bearing play cannot be measured, but input shaft play is perceptible and the input shaft turns freely, the adjustment is also acceptable.
